I read this as part of a yearlong Bronte sisters readalong and I loved it! It may be my favourite so far, although it in infuriating and at times bleak, Anne Bronte doesn't shy away from portraying her characters' flaws and weaknesses as well as the dangers and consequences of alcoholism - on both the alcoholic and their loved ones.
